The Euro Only Benefits Rich Countries
Euromyth No. 82 min
Verfügbar bis zum 02/03/2039
Since the Euro was introduced, economic inequality between member states has risen. Some EU citizens believe that the single currency and the Stability and Growth Pact are entirely responsible. As ever, the reality is more nuanced.
